Q.

The acute angle between the planes P1 and P2, when P1 and P2 are the planes passing through the intersection of the planes 5x + 8y + 13z - 29 = 0 and 8x - 7y + z - 20 = 0 and the points (2, 1, 3) and (0, 1, 2), respectively, is

Detailed Solution

detailed_solution_thumbnail

Equation of the plane passing through the line of intersection of  5x+8y+13z29=0 and 8x7y+z20=0 is 5x+8y+3z29+λ(8x7y+z20)=0 and if it  is passing through the point (2,1,3) then λ=72

5x+8y+3z29+72(8x7y+z20)=0P1=2xy+z=6

Equation of the plane passing through the line of intersection of  5x+8y+13z29=0 and 8x7y+z20=0 and the point (0,1,2) isx+y+2z=5

 Angle between planes =θ=cos1366=π3
